Day 1: Arrival in London
Arrive in the afternoon and settle into your accommodation. Spend the evening exploring the local area and enjoy a leisurely dinner at a nearby restaurant. Consider dining at Dishoom in Covent Garden for a taste of Bombay comfort food or Flat Iron for a delicious steak experience.
Day 2: Exploring Westminster and Southbank
Morning: Start your day with a visit to the iconic Westminster Abbey,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and the traditional place of coronation for British monarchs. Don't miss the chance to see the Houses of Parliament and Big Ben.

Afternoon: Head to the Southbank, where you can enjoy a leisurely walk along the Thames River. Visit the Tate Modern for contemporary art and take a ride on the London Eye for stunning views of the city.
Night: Enjoy dinner at Skylon, offering panoramic views of the Thames, or try Gordon Ramsay's Union Street Café for a Mediterranean-inspired menu.
Day 3: Royal London and Shopping
Morning: Visit the Tower of London to see the Crown Jewels and learn about the history of this iconic fortress.

Afternoon: Head to Buckingham Palace to witness the Changing of the Guard. Afterwards, explore the luxury shops of Bond Street and Regent Street.
Night: Dine at The Wolseley, a grand café-restaurant offering a mix of European dishes, or enjoy a traditional British meal at Rules, London's oldest restaurant.
Day 4: Day Trip to Stonehenge and Bath
All Day: Embark on a day trip to explore the prehistoric marvel of Stonehenge and the Roman city of Bath. Consider booking the Stonehenge, Windsor Castle, and Bath Day Trip for a comprehensive experience.

Day 5: Cultural Immersion in London
Morning: Visit the British Museum to explore its vast collection of art and antiquities. Don't miss the Rosetta Stone and the Elgin Marbles.
Afternoon: Head to the vibrant neighborhood of Camden for eclectic shopping and street food. Explore the Camden Market for unique finds and delicious bites.
Night: Experience the magic of a West End show. Consider booking tickets for popular productions like The Lion King or Les Misérables.
Day 6: Harry Potter and Hidden Gems
Morning: Dive into the magical world of Harry Potter with a visit to the Warner Bros. Studio Tour. Explore the sets, costumes, and props from the beloved film series.

Afternoon: Discover the hidden gems of London with a visit to the Leighton House Museum or the Sir John Soane's Museum, both offering unique insights into the city's artistic heritage.
Night: Enjoy a dinner cruise on the Thames River with the London Dinner Cruise, offering a delightful evening of food, wine, and entertainment.

Day 7: Departure
Spend your final morning in London with a leisurely breakfast at The Breakfast Club in Soho or Duck & Waffle for stunning views. Take a last stroll through Hyde Park or visit the Victoria and Albert Museum before heading to the airport for your departure.
